About 12,800,000 results
Open links in new tab
Make video calls right from your browser | Skype
The new Skype for Web is here
Skype | Stay connected with free video calls worldwide
Skype
Try Skype without a Skype account - Microsoft Support
Finding your way around Skype for Web - Microsoft Support
Skype
Skype | Free calls to friends and family
Skype for Web (Preview) is here! - Microsoft Community
Skype